This week’s themes: Updating, Remembering, Needing, Wearing, Being.

Updating. My website.  And my business cards.  And my Etsy site.  And my Instagram.  And everything else business related.  Holy crap…May 1 is basically TOMORROW and I am not ready for everything yet.  But guess what?  Thread & Grain is happening, people!!

Remembering. How much fun it is to learn new things.  I think the brilliant part of Bennett’s and my combo is that we aren’t afraid to try something new.  That we might not have any clue about.  We read as much as we can and then delve into it…stumbling our way though most things until we find our groove.  We might not be the best at anything, but damnit if we aren’t willing to learn and try.

Needing. A way to stop time.  One month from now, it’s going to be Louis’ last day of school.  Of preschool.  He’s going to be a Kindergarten student and will be going five days a week, all day long.  My Momma heart cannot handle this realization.  I think maybe I can talk to the teachers about holding him back indefinitely…so he stays in Preschool forever.  Is that how this works?

Wearing. A smile, along with some new me-made clothes.  I bought a whole slew of spring/summer fabrics and haven’t had the chance to really make anything with them yet.  I’m itching to sew all the things!  But for now, I’ll settle for this pleather sleeved number.

Being. Super excited!  I’m now officially the host (and co-host!) of two blog tours coming up in May and June.  Angelica and I are bringing another round of Wear to Where? and I just put up the signups for “Sew Americana”, a red/white/blue loving tour of sewing….to hit right before Independence Day.  I’m super excited!
